DUCATI’S DESERTX RALLY: WHERE IT SHINES

2 years ago | Words: Andy Wigan | Photos: Ducati Media House

On paper, Ducati’s DesertX Rally model is significantly different from the ‘standard’ DesertX it’s based on. But does its longer suspension travel mean a loss in road-going prowess? How significant is the Rally model’s performance advantage when you take it into more challenging off-road terrain? And does that advantage warrant a $12,000 price tag premium!

At the Rally model’s recent international media launch in Morocco, we compared notes about the two DesertX models’ relative performance with Nick Selleck, an Aussie guy who’s been involved in the development phase of these landmark new models for Ducati…
